Kind Service-
No need to leave the building basically
9.7
The concierge clerk was extremely nice and have given us all that we requested.
The room was exquisite of course since all of their rooms are suite rooms.
There is the pool and mini golf course of course which I were not able to use due to bad weather but has good reviews. If you are not into gambling, there's not much to do. The Shopping area does not contain that many brands which was disappointing and the food court only accept cash which was odd.
I would rather stay that the Hard Rock which is right across and newer (modern).But if your choice is to stay in classic hotels, I guess it's the Venetian.
The morning buffet is known to be the larger buffet in the world... but I thought it was.. okay... Not bad but not memorable.

did not live up to the hype
5
let's take it point by point...
are the rooms nice large and nicely furnished? - yes
is the service and facilities worth of a 5 star hotel? - no, not even close...
everything is focused understandably on the casino, but rooms service was just plain bad, housekeeping and minibar stormed into the room several times without knocking and even a privacy sign was out, the rooms themselves are quite dated already, with tv's who have an aweful channel selection and if you want to book any of the "pay movies" and watch them it does not work either...
to make things worst, you get nickeled and dimed to death...
hk$ 160 for internet access ,plus breakfast charges, plus anything extra is being charged ... just not worth the hassle...

A good hotel to stay in with tons of things to do, shopping, golf, gondola rides and gambling. Across the street is where you can watch theater shows and what else, more gambling.
Excellent rooms, excellent decorations, excellent staff.
All rooms are suites and a decent size for a family.
I would recommend staying here for everyone, unless there is a particular casino you are planning to lose money to.
Only downside is that you need to walk through the casino in order to get to the hotel rooms. So if you have kids be prepared for a long walk!
